Portál AbcLinuxu, 10. května 2025 12:19

Dotaz: Rozdelenie particii SSD a HDD a zarovnanie SSD

2.9.2012 21:51 bodo
Rozdelenie particii SSD a HDD a zarovnanie SSD
Přečteno: 2388×
Odpovědět | Admin
Ahoj,

mam novy NTB v ktorom mam 500GB HDD a 256GB SSD Crucial m4.

1. Zarovnaval uz niekto particie na SSD pomocou GParted? Tu je popisany navod ako na to, je to relevantny navod alebo je to blbost. Ku gdisku sa neviem nejak dostat (particie chcem vytvorit cez Ubuntu live), cize preto gparted.

Ake by bolo idealne rozdelenie particii? Premyslal som na niecim takym:

SSD:

HDD:
  1. /swap - 10GB - hibernacia (aktualna RAM 8GB)
  2. /mnt/data - (zvyskok)GB - multimedia, zdrojaky
tmp - tmpfs - takze pojde do ram

Suborovy system ext4.

Dava to zmysel, pripadne co by bolo idealnejsie?

Dost dlho som fungoval na Archlinuxe, na novy NTB asi zvolim Ubuntu 12.04 LTS, je nieco na co by som si mal dat pozor pri instalacii vzhladom na SSD?

Dakujem za odpovede.

Řešení dotazu:


Nástroje: Začni sledovat (1)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

Jendа avatar 3.9.2012 01:31 Jendа | skóre: 78 | blog: Jenda | JO70FB
Rozbalit Rozbalit vše Re: Rozdelenie particii SSD a HDD a zarovnanie SSD
Odpovědět | | Sbalit | Link | Blokovat | Admin
Zarovnání oddílů by mělo být jednoduché, ještě si pak vypiš partition tabulku třeba fdisk -l a spočítej si, že to fakt začíná na sektoru dělitelném 8 MiB. cryptsetupu se pak dá něco jako --align-payload=8192 a taky to bude zarovnané. Snad :-).

Osobně bych asi nedal /home, / a /var zvlášť, pokud bych k tomu neměl nějaký důvod (požadavek na oddělené šifrování nebo jiné nastavení FS - což by se zde vlastně hodilo, možná by jim šlo nastavit různě dlouhý commit, ale to zase hrozí ztrátou dat při crashi. IMHO to SSD nezničíš do doby, než bude 256 GB SSD za pár šupů, tak se tímhle možná nemusíš tak zabývat).

Nevím, jestli by se nevyplatilo dát na /mnt/data (btw. klidně bych to namountoval někam do tvého ~) XFS nebo nějaký jiný FS, který umí defragmentaci.
Jendа avatar 3.9.2012 01:48 Jendа | skóre: 78 | blog: Jenda | JO70FB
Rozbalit Rozbalit vše Re: Rozdelenie particii SSD a HDD a zarovnanie SSD
Apropo co si myslíte o vypínání žurnálu u filesystému na SSD?
3.9.2012 11:49 Šangala | skóre: 56 | blog: Dutá Vrba - Wally
Rozbalit Rozbalit vše Re: Rozdelenie particii SSD a HDD a zarovnanie SSD
Tak já třeba si nemyslím nic - mám ho zapnutý, protože si říkám, že mi může být k užitku a „věřím“, že SSD to zvládne…
Jinak: Ext4 lze také napovědět -E stripe-width=128.
To, že trpíš stihomamem, ještě neznamená, že po tobě nejdou. ⰞⰏⰉⰓⰀⰜⰉ ⰗⰞⰅⰜⰘ ⰈⰅⰏⰉ ⰒⰑⰎⰉⰁⰕⰅ ⰏⰉ ⰒⰓⰄⰅⰎ ·:⁖⁘⁙†
13.9.2012 11:14 Roman DAVID | skóre: 24 | Brno
Rozbalit Rozbalit vše Re: Rozdelenie particii SSD a HDD a zarovnanie SSD
Nevypinam, ale prodluzuji commit time na nekolik minut (cca 3-5), zejmena pokud se jedna o notebook.
10.9.2012 13:19 trubicoid
Rozbalit Rozbalit vše Re: Rozdelenie particii SSD a HDD a zarovnanie SSD
ext4 tedy uz umi defragmentaci pomoci e4defrag, ale tez bych doporucil xfs
10.9.2012 13:31 bodo | skóre: 3
Rozbalit Rozbalit vše Re: Rozdelenie particii SSD a HDD a zarovnanie SSD
Na HDD som dal xfs, ocakavam ze to bude lepsie pracovat s objemnejsimi subormi. Este taka podotazka, prevadzkovanie virtualbox machine-s na ssd ma nejaky vyrazny vplyv na jeho zivotnost? Ako je na tom virtualbox s write operaciami, ako hostovany file system by mal zapisovat do jedineho VDI suboru podla toho co som sa docital.
10.9.2012 14:40 trubicoid
Rozbalit Rozbalit vše Re: Rozdelenie particii SSD a HDD a zarovnanie SSD
v nastaveni virtual boxu je pod Storage moznost zatrhnout Solid-state drive. co to ale ve skutecnosti dela, nevim :(
10.9.2012 15:01 bodo | skóre: 3
Rozbalit Rozbalit vše Re: Rozdelenie particii SSD a HDD a zarovnanie SSD
Ano docital som sa ze by to malo "optimalizovat" IO operacie pre SSD, ale vacsinou to bolo len pre WIN 7, kde je to vraj na 100% spojazdnene, netusim ako je na tom linux. Kazdopadne vyskusam placnut machinu na ssd a uvidim co to da. Aj ked zlate pravidlo vm je mat to na inom disku ako OS.
10.9.2012 16:00 trubicoid
Rozbalit Rozbalit vše Re: Rozdelenie particii SSD a HDD a zarovnanie SSD
ja tu volbu vidim v macosx-u, ale nevim, co to dela; mozna projde TRIM? pry 4.2 RC1 by to mel asi umet: https://forums.virtualbox.org/viewtopic.php?f=6&t=50934
Řešení 1× (bodo)
10.9.2012 08:03 bodo | skóre: 3
Rozbalit Rozbalit vše Re: Rozdelenie particii SSD a HDD a zarovnanie SSD
Odpovědět | | Sbalit | Link | Blokovat | Admin
Takze cez weekend sa mi podarilo nainstalovat system. Na Ubuntu som sa vykaslal a nainstaloval som tam Arch-a. Dovod prosty, mam s nim skusenosti a wiki ma archlinux neprekonatelnu, spolu s uzivatelskou komunitou, kde sa pohybuju vacsnou ludia s uz nejakymi skusenostami s linuxom.

Disk som nakoniec rozdelil takto:

SSD: / - 30GB (prepodpoklad 8 - 12Gb zhltne var a cache balickov pacmana) /home - cca. 200GB

HDD: /swap - 10GB (suspend na disk) /mount/data - zvyskok

HDD obsahuje aj FAT32 particiu pre EFI bootloader a ponechal som aj "zaplateny" WIN7.

Na rozdelenie particii som pouzil gdisk, vpodstate blbuvzdorny, sam zarovnava particie aby boli delitelne 1024, co by malo vyhovovat vacsine diskov, podla toho co som sa docital.
15.9.2012 19:43 aceman | skóre: 27
Rozbalit Rozbalit vše Re: Rozdelenie particii SSD a HDD a zarovnanie SSD
Odpovědět | | Sbalit | Link | Blokovat | Admin
Ako to teda ma byt zarovnane? Je taketo rozdelenie v poriadku? Na celom disku je len 1 particia:
fdisk -l /dev/sdb

Disk /dev/sdb: 32.0 GB, 32017047552 bytes
132 heads, 63 sectors/track, 7519 cylinders, total 62533296 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es

   Device Boot      Start         End      Blocks   Id  System
/dev/sdb1              63    62533295    31266616+  83  Linux
17.9.2012 08:09 bodo | skóre: 3
Rozbalit Rozbalit vše Re: Rozdelenie particii SSD a HDD a zarovnanie SSD
Nepouzivaj fdisk ak ho uz pouzivas riad sa tymto SSD Partition Alignment. Nie je to vporiadku, cislo by malo byt delitelne 1024 aby si dostal 512K blok s ktorym moze SSD pracovat (mazat atd). V principe ako to chapem ja je ze kedze SSD ma rodielny sposob fungovania ako klasicky HDD disk. SSD disk uklada data po blokoch zvycajne 1blok = 512KB, kazdy blok sa sklada z 4KB stranky cize dokopy jeden blok ma 128 stranok. SSD disk vymazava data po blokoch, teda ak su zapisane na aspon jednej stranke data, ssd disk vymaze kompletne cely blok. Ak mas nezarovnany ssd disk tak sa moze stat ze data sice uklada pravidelne do blokov ale kedze nemaju pravidelny tvar tak data sa zapisuju sposobom vyssie uvedenym ze sa v niektorych pripadoch nezapisuje cely blok ale iba par stranok, co samozrejme zdrzuje, preto sa SSD zarovnavaju. Ak pouzijes na zarovnanie gdisk tak tento automaticky zarovnava na cisla delitelne 1024 (zaciatok je teda 2048), ak mas UEFI a GPT partion tak vpodstate ani nic ine ako gdisk nemozes pouzit.

Celkom uzitocne je precitat si aj toto Archlinux Partition Alignment

P.S - Opravte ma ak popis preco sa zarovnava je chybny.
17.9.2012 09:10 Šangala | skóre: 56 | blog: Dutá Vrba - Wally
Rozbalit Rozbalit vše Re: Rozdelenie particii SSD a HDD a zarovnanie SSD
A taky se neustále přepisují „buňky“, které nejsou potřeba přepisovat a snižuje se životnost SSD disku.
Například každý zápis na začátek partition, může přepisovat neustále MBR nebo zápis na konec partition přepisuje i začátek následující (přečtou se data, doplní se změna a zapíše se celý blok zpět).
To, že trpíš stihomamem, ještě neznamená, že po tobě nejdou. ⰞⰏⰉⰓⰀⰜⰉ ⰗⰞⰅⰜⰘ ⰈⰅⰏⰉ ⰒⰑⰎⰉⰁⰕⰅ ⰏⰉ ⰒⰓⰄⰅⰎ ·:⁖⁘⁙†
17.9.2012 20:38 aceman | skóre: 27
Rozbalit Rozbalit vše Re: Rozdelenie particii SSD a HDD a zarovnanie SSD
Dik. Linka ale nefunguje. Je tam nejaka chyba?

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.